TOM CLANCY’S SPLINTER CELL: CONVICTION
Splinter Cell: Conviction wasn’t officially announced by Ubisoft until early 2007, but the existence of the game had actually been leaked long before that. A few months before the official announcement, about 2 GB of files were stolen from Ubisoft servers. These files mostly contained concept art for a number of games, and one of these was actually Conviction. Given the drastic change in direction the series took with this game, the leaking of concept art before it was even announced obviously would not have sat well with Ubisoft.
